Output 84cf31efa60fe82f6e17d77147167a269f032c8ea19dbe337fc982ffb9554dc7:0

value
1088309
script pubkey
OP_0 OP_PUSHBYTES_20 77927a836ebe5dfa3e7d0f37e426f74e1979a45e
address
bc1qw7f84qmwhewl50napum7gfhhfcvhnfz70qmg29
transaction
84cf31efa60fe82f6e17d77147167a269f032c8ea19dbe337fc982ffb9554dc7
spent
true